Output 2ba0463fcc5146d0274fce1ddeb90c1e608cd2caae2e200023450aff5dbebb3a:0

value
8774835
script pubkey
OP_0 OP_PUSHBYTES_20 0c1ebefbd8d8fbe307e9cb515eb398bfa25579ef
address
bc1qps0ta77cmra7xplfedg4avuch739270038se2d
transaction
2ba0463fcc5146d0274fce1ddeb90c1e608cd2caae2e200023450aff5dbebb3a
confirmations
143860
spent
false